Proverbs 12:23 — Bible Verse (KJV)

“A prudent man concealeth knowledge: but the heart of fools proclaimeth foolishness.”

Proverbs 12:23 — King James Version (KJV), 1611

Proverbs 12:23 WEB — World English Bible (2000)

“A prudent man keeps his knowledge, but the hearts of fools proclaim foolishness.”

Proverbs 12:23 — World English Bible

Proverbs 12:23 ASV — American Standard Version (1901)

“A prudent man concealeth knowledge; But the heart of fools proclaimeth foolishness.”

Proverbs 12:23 — American Standard Version

Proverbs 12:23 YLT — Young's Literal Translation (1862)

“A prudent man is concealing knowledge, And the heart of fools proclaimeth folly.”

Proverbs 12:23 — Young's Literal Translation

Proverbs 12:23 DBY — Darby Translation (1890)

“A prudent man concealeth knowledge; but the heart of the foolish proclaimeth folly.”

Proverbs 12:23 — Darby Translation

Proverbs 12:23 GEN — Geneva Bible (1599)

“A wise man concealeth knowledge: but the heart of the fooles publisheth foolishnes.”

Proverbs 12:23 — Geneva Bible
